A Sensitive Urinary Lipoarabinomannan Test for Tuberculosis

WebMar 24, 2010 · In confirmed TB patients, the LAM test was more sensitive than sputum smear microscopy (42%, 82 of 193, P < 0.001) and detected 56% (62 of 111) of those who were sputum smear negative.
